Coastal structures are constantly exposed to harsh environmental conditions such as saltwater, moisture, and extreme weather. Our Coastal Structure Reinforcement Project focuses on enhancing durability and structural integrity using advanced materials like GFRP (Glass Fiber Reinforced Polymer) rebar.

Unlike traditional steel, GFRP rebar offers excellent corrosion resistance, making it ideal for marine environments such as seawalls, piers, bridges, and coastal protection systems. This significantly reduces maintenance costs and extends the lifespan of structures.
